Scott's Chicken and Quinoa Salad Recipe
2017-04-10 13:06:17
Serves 4
Ingredients
- 2 cups sunrice quinoa and brown rice mix
- 1/2 bag spinach
- 1 spring onion
- handful of coriander and mint
- good shake of cumin and all spice
- 1 chicken breast per person
- 1 lime
- 1 avocado
- handful of watercress
Instructions
- Cook quinoa & brown rice mix as per instructions on packet.
- Blitz spinach, spring onion, coriander and mint in a blender. Doesn't need to be super smooth - rustic is the look we're going for.
- Bash chicken until flat-ish. Slice into pieces.
- Coat chicken in all spice and cumin.
- Cook chicken in pan.
- Stir spinach mix through cooked quinoa. Add juice from the lime.
- Serve quinoa on plate, top with chicken.
- Add pieces of avocado (Scott uses a potato peeler for this. You could cut the avo into chunks. Whatever works for you)
- Add sprigs of fresh watercress and enjoy!
